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Sudbury Hill Harrow to Kingsknowe start from as little as £45.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Sudbury Hill Harrow to Kingsknowe start from £100.50 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Sudbury Hill Harrow to Kingsknowe are available for £206.00 one way

Station Facilities and Amenities

Sudbury Hill Harrow station is straightforward, with a focus on simplicity. It does not have a ticket office or machines, so it is advisable to purchase your train tickets in advance online or through apps to avoid any inconvenience. While the station lacks step-free access and traditional comforts like waiting rooms and refreshments, it is equipped with customer help points and induction loops for those needing hearing assistance.

If you require assistance during your journey, it is beneficial to plan and book ahead. Sudbury Hill Harrow is an unstaffed station, but help is never far away. You can use their Passenger Assist service for booking additional support, or connect with the helpline by following this link.

Accessibility at the Station

For travellers who might need mobility assistance, it’s good to know that Sudbury Hill Harrow has limited accessibility options. The station falls within Step-Free Access Category C, meaning there is no direct step-free access to the platforms. If necessary, alternative arrangements to the nearest accessible station can be organized. Don’t hesitate to utilize the helpful contact points available at the station in case you encounter any issues.

Facilities and Amenities at Kingsknowe

Kingsknowe might be compact, but it gets the basics right. While the station doesn't boast a ticket office, ticket machines, or even smartcard issuance, it does have smartcard validators, which might benefit the regular commuter. For those requiring a bit of help with their onward journey, there's a help point providing information. While there's no staff available on-site to assist, customer support can be reached via phone or email.

Accessibility is a mixed bag here. The station is categorized as a Category B station, indicating partial step-free access, with ramps to both platforms and a level crossing facilitating ease of movement. However, there are no accessible ticket machines, toilet facilities, or even waiting rooms, which can be a concern for some passengers. If you need to plan for accessibility, you might want to check out the assistance booking service offered through Passenger Assist. For cyclists, there are 10 bicycle spaces provided, although these are not sheltered or covered by CCTV.
